Occupying a substantial & imposing plot some 40 foot in width sits this sizeable five double bedroom semi, which has undergone extensive renovation works by the current owners.

When scouring West London's riverside, it is beyond a rarity these days to come across a residence similar to this which has not be separated into individual units, so to find a home of this scale and condition is almost unheard of.

Buyers will love the property's showpiece kitchen, the huge entertaining space which comfortable houses a grand piano and room to entertain the masses along with two further separate reception spaces currently being utilised as a large snug and home studio space.

The theme of style, space & impeccable design continues throughout the top floors of the house with each of the bedrooms being sizeable doubles with two of the three stunning bathrooms being brand new and the master bedroom suit offering both an ensuite bathroom and separate dressing area.

Some special mentions for the inside of this house must be made for the downstairs 'boot room' a feature which we are sure many buyers will love, the host of original features to include a dumbwaiter lift, original coving and exterior brick & stonework detailing which really makes the house stand out.

It would be hard for the exterior of this fine house to not grab the plaudits here thou with its huge drive (a real rarity for a home of this era) and the showpiece rear garden measuring some 170ft in length which includes a real 'adults hang out' of a dining area overlooking the Thames, complete with its own hot tub and even a separate 'writers caravan' with mini kitchenette. The real showstopper however has to be the floating private pontoon which offers a buyer a private mooring and is accessed directly from the property allowing the perfect point to keep a family boat or launch a paddleboard or kayak through the warmer summer months.
